5. BELT PULLEY INSTALLATION ONTO KEYWAY-TYPE CRANKSHAFT
When installing the belt pulley and/or clutch onto keyway-type
crankshaft (PTO shaft), proper and correct arrangements are needed.
The following illustration shows the correct installation of the applicable
component parts.

Key Location
When using the belt pulley with the extended boss on both
side as shown in the illustration, put the spacer so that the
key stays in the keyway portion of the crankshaft.

Belt Pulley Installation
Install the belt pulley in the no over-hang condition as shown
in the illustration.
